mirror of
https://gitee.com/dromara/dax-pay.git
synced 2025-09-08 05:27:59 +00:00
feat 增加分账接收者列表接口和一些优化
This commit is contained in:
@@ -1,6 +1,22 @@
|
||||
# CHANGELOG
|
||||
## [v3.0.0.beta1] 2024-10-24
|
||||
|
||||
- 重构: JDK版本升级为21+, Spring Boot 版本升级为3.3.x, 前端组件升级为Antd Vue 4.x + Vite5
|
||||
- 重构: 数据库更新为PostgreSQL + MySQL8.x 双版本支持
|
||||
- 重构: 脚手架全新重构, 精简和优化各种功能模块, 支持基于有赞文章实现的Redis延时队列
|
||||
- 重构: 支持多应用模式, 每个应用都可以配置单独一套支付通道、通知订阅、收款码牌等配置, 可以实现同时对接多个业务系统
|
||||
- 重构: 项目结构进行重构, 修改为支付核心+通道扩展+功能插件的方式, 实现功能模块的耦合拆分, 便于进行功能扩展和二次开发
|
||||
- 重构: 对账功能进行重构, 更加简单直观和易用
|
||||
- 重构: 删除订单调整相关逻辑, 分别放到订单同步和回调处理中, 只保留
|
||||
- 新增: 微信支付同时支持V2和V3版本的接口, 同时V3版本支持付款码和撤销接口
|
||||
- 新增: 交易调试接口功能, 用于开发时对交易流程进行测试
|
||||
- 新增: 获取通道认证信息的测试页, 便于获取微信、支付宝等用户的认证信息
|
||||
- 新增: 增加简易移动端收款码牌功能, 支持自动跳转到微信或支付宝对应的H5收银台, 支持自主配置所使用的通道和支付方式
|
||||
- 新增: 增加商户通知功能, 通过订阅指定类型的通知类型, 将会在符合条件时推送到预留的客户系统地址上
|
||||
- 优化: 各类错误处理进行统一化处理
|
||||
- 优化: 优化商户回调功能, 简化配置项, 使用延时器优化重复推送的逻辑
|
||||
- 优化: 减少在各种流程中上下文对象的线程变量使用, 非必需的上下文对象使用方法调用明确传输
|
||||
- 优化: 对各类状态码进行优化合并, 如转账接收方类型、分账接收方类型等
|
||||
- 优化: 所有金额统一为元, 保留两位小数
|
||||
## [v2.0.8] 2024-06-27
|
||||
- 新增: 撤销接口
|
||||
- 新增: 转账功能
|
||||
|
Reference in New Issue
Block a user